Abstract

The invention discloses a liquid mildew-proof lubricating sterilization cream, which relates to the technical field of mildew-proof agents and comprises the following components in parts by weight: 30-50 parts of calcium chloride, 10-25 parts of ash calcium, 1-5 parts of plasticizer, 5-15 parts of nano activated carbon powder, 1-5 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 1-5 parts of water-soluble silicone oil, 10-55 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one, 1-5 parts of dispersant, 1-5 parts of defoaming agent and 20-50 parts of deionized water. The synergistic effect of various effective components has better and longer-acting mildew-proof effect, low toxicity, easy operation, wide application range and capability of being used as a lubricant.

Description

Liquid mildew-proof lubricating sterilization cream
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of mildew inhibitors, and in particular relates to a liquid mildew-proof lubricating sterilization cream.
Background
An agent for preventing mold formation caused by microorganisms. There are phenols (such as phenol), chlorophenols (such as pentachlorophenol), organic mercuric salts (such as phenylmercuric oleate), organic copper salts (such as copper 8-hydroxyquinoline), organic tin salts (such as triethylenechloride or tributyltin chloride), and inorganic salts such as copper sulfate, mercuric chloride, sodium fluoride, etc. The composite material is used for plastics, rubber, textiles, paint, insulating materials and the like. The main components of the mildew preventive are as follows: quaternary ammonium salt derivatives, cason, surfactants, synergists and the like. An agent for preventing mold formation caused by microorganisms. There are phenols (such as phenol), chlorophenols (such as pentachlorophenol), organic mercuric salts (such as phenylmercuric oleate), organic copper salts (such as copper 8-hydroxyquinoline), organic tin salts (such as triethylenechloride or tributyltin chloride), and inorganic salts such as copper sulfate, mercuric chloride, sodium fluoride, etc. The composite material is used for plastics, rubber, textiles, paint, insulating materials and the like. The mildew preventive is classified into a mildew preventive for cosmetics, a mildew preventive for washing products and a broad-spectrum bactericide, namely a leather mildew preventive and a wood mildew preventive, and has strong inhibiting and killing effects on bacteria, fungi and algae. Is mainly suitable for daily use such as cosmetics, washing products, gel water, cream, liquid soap, wet tissue and the like.
The mildew-proof agent applied to flat substrates, coatings and diatom ooze putty powder at present has poor mildew-proof effect, and needs to be improved urgently.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a reasonably designed liquid mildew-proof bactericidal cream aiming at the defects and shortcomings of the prior art, which has the synergistic effect of a plurality of effective components, better and longer-acting mildew-proof effect, low toxicity, easy operation, wide application range and capability of being used as a lubricant.
In order to achieve the purpose, the invention adopts the following technical scheme: the composition comprises the following components in parts by weight: 30-50 parts of calcium chloride, 10-25 parts of ash calcium, 1-5 parts of plasticizer, 5-15 parts of nano activated carbon powder, 1-5 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 1-5 parts of water-soluble silicone oil, 10-55 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one, 1-5 parts of dispersant, 1-5 parts of defoaming agent and 20-50 parts of deionized water.
Further, the liquid mildew-proof sterilization cream comprises the following components in parts by weight: 45-50 parts of calcium chloride, 20-25 parts of ash calcium, 1-5 parts of plasticizer, 10-15 parts of nano activated carbon powder, 1-5 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 1-5 parts of water-soluble silicone oil, 45-55 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one, 1-5 parts of dispersant, 1-5 parts of defoamer and 40-50 parts of deionized water.
Further, the liquid mildew-proof sterilization cream comprises the following components in parts by weight: 30-35 parts of calcium chloride, 10-15 parts of ash calcium, 1-3 parts of plasticizer, 5-12 parts of nano activated carbon powder, 1-3 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 1-3 parts of water-soluble silicone oil, 10-20 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one, 1-3 parts of dispersant, 1-3 parts of defoamer and 20-25 parts of deionized water.
Further, the plasticizer comprises one or more of dibutyl phthalate, di-n-octyl phthalate and diisononyl phthalate.
Further, the dispersing agent comprises one or more of stearic acid monoglyceride, microcrystalline paraffin and polyethylene glycol 200.
Further, the defoaming agent comprises one or more of tributyl phosphate, higher alcohols, phenethyl alcohol oleate and lauryl phenylacetate.
The processing technology of the invention is as follows:
1. 30-50 parts of calcium chloride, 10-25 parts of ash calcium and 5-15 parts of nano activated carbon powder by mass are put into a stirring device to be uniformly mixed and stirred;
2. 1-5 parts of plasticizer, 1-5 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 1-5 parts of water-soluble silicone oil, 10-55 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one and 1-5 parts of dispersant by mass are put into a high-speed dispersion machine and stirred and dispersed uniformly, then the mixed powder obtained in the step 1 is added into the uniformly dispersed liquid mixture, the mixture is stirred and dispersed continuously, and finally 20-50 parts of deionized water by weight are put into the high-speed dispersion machine and dispersed at a high speed for 20 minutes and then dispersed at a low speed for 1-1.5 hours;
3. adding 1-5 parts by mass of a defoaming agent into the mixed solution after low-speed dispersion in the step 2, slowly mixing, stirring and defoaming;
4. and (3) feeding the defoamed mixed solution into distillation concentration equipment for distillation concentration to obtain a paste, detecting the quality, and finally cutting and packaging according to the specification.
After the components and the processing technology are adopted, the beneficial effects of the invention are as follows: the invention provides a liquid mildew-proof lubricating sterilization cream, which has the synergistic effect of a plurality of effective components, has better and longer-acting mildew-proof effect, low toxicity, easy operation, wide application range and wide application range, and can be used as a lubricant.
The specific implementation mode is as follows:
the specific implementation mode (embodiment one) adopts the following technical scheme: the composition comprises the following components in parts by weight: 40 parts of calcium chloride, 20 parts of ash calcium, 12 parts of nano activated carbon powder, 4 parts of plasticizer, 4 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 4 parts of water-soluble silicone oil, 45 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one, 3 parts of dispersant, 4 parts of defoamer and 45 parts of deionized water; the plasticizer comprises a mixture of dibutyl phthalate, di-n-octyl phthalate and diisononyl phthalate; the dispersing agent comprises a mixture of stearic acid monoglyceride, microcrystalline paraffin and polyethylene glycol 200; the defoaming agent comprises a mixture of tributyl phosphate, higher alcohol, phenethyl alcohol oleate and lauryl phenylacetate.
The processing technology of the specific embodiment is as follows:
1. putting 40 parts by mass of calcium chloride, 20 parts by mass of ash calcium and 12 parts by mass of nano activated carbon powder into stirring equipment, and uniformly mixing and stirring;
2. 4 parts of plasticizer, 4 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 4 parts of water-soluble silicone oil, 45 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one and 3 parts of dispersant in parts by mass are put into a high-speed dispersion machine and stirred and dispersed uniformly, then the mixed powder obtained in the step 1 is added into the uniformly dispersed liquid mixture, the mixture is stirred and dispersed continuously, and finally 45 parts of deionized water in parts by weight are put into the high-speed dispersion machine and dispersed at high speed for 20 minutes and then dispersed at low speed for 1 hour;
3. adding 4 parts by mass of defoaming agent into the mixed solution after low-speed dispersion in the step 2, slowly mixing, stirring and defoaming;
4. and (3) feeding the defoamed mixed solution into a distillation concentration device for distillation concentration to obtain a paste, detecting the quality, and finally cutting and packaging according to the net content of 25 kg/block.
The method of use of this example is as follows: the paste is added into the coating according to 0.3-1.5% of the total amount of the exterior wall coating, the paste is added into the interior wall coating according to 0.2-1.0% of the total amount of the interior wall coating, the addition amount can be properly adjusted according to the performance and the using environment of the product, the application concentration is higher in the high-temperature and high-humidity environment in the south, and the application concentration can be 0.3-1.0% in the north and the inland.
After the components and the processing technology are adopted, the beneficial effects of the specific embodiment are as follows: the specific embodiment provides a liquid mildew-proof lubricating sterilization cream, which effectively adsorbs granular components such as d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one, calcium chloride and gray calcium by utilizing the high-strength adsorption performance of nano activated carbon particles, so that the stability of the whole mildew-proof sterilization cream is improved, the situations of desorption, separation, dispersion and the like caused by external environment change and the like are avoided, the prepared mildew-proof sterilization cream has a better and longer mildew-proof effect, the toxicity is low, the operation is easy, the liquid mildew-proof lubricating sterilization cream can be used as a lubricant, and the application range is wide.
Example two:
the liquid mildew-proof sterilization cream in the embodiment comprises the following components in parts by weight: 50 parts of calcium chloride, 20 parts of ash calcium, 5 parts of plasticizer, 10 parts of nano activated carbon powder, 5 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 1 part of water-soluble silicone oil, 55 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one, 1 part of dispersant, 2 parts of defoamer and 40 parts of deionized water; the plasticizer is dibutyl phthalate; the dispersing agent is a mixture of stearic acid monoglyceride and microcrystalline paraffin; the defoaming agent is a mixture of tributyl phosphate, high-carbon alcohol and phenethyl alcohol oleate.
The processing technology of the embodiment is as follows:
1. 50 parts of calcium chloride, 20 parts of ash calcium and 10 parts of nano activated carbon powder in mass fraction are put into a stirring device to be mixed and stirred uniformly;
2. 5 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 1 part of water-soluble silicone oil, 55 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one and 1 part of dispersant by mass are put into a high-speed dispersion machine to be uniformly stirred and dispersed, the mixed powder obtained in the step 1 is added into the uniformly dispersed liquid mixture to be continuously stirred and dispersed, and finally 40 parts of deionized water by weight is put into the high-speed dispersion machine to be dispersed for 20 minutes at high speed and then dispersed for 1.5 hours at low speed;
3. 2 parts of defoaming agent is added into the mixed solution after low-speed dispersion in the step 2, and the mixture is slowly mixed, stirred and defoamed;
4. and (3) feeding the defoamed mixed solution into a distillation concentration device for distillation concentration to obtain a paste, detecting the quality, and finally cutting and packaging according to the net content of 25 kg/block.
Example three:
the liquid mildew-proof sterilization cream in the embodiment comprises the following components in parts by weight: 35 parts of calcium chloride, 12 parts of ash calcium, 2 parts of plasticizer, 10 parts of nano activated carbon powder, 2 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 2 parts of water-soluble silicone oil, 18 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one, 2 parts of dispersant, 2 parts of defoamer and 22 parts of deionized water; the plasticizer is a mixture of dibutyl phthalate and di-n-octyl phthalate; the dispersant is stearic acid monoglyceride; the defoaming agent is tributyl phosphate.
The processing technology of the embodiment is as follows:
1. putting 35 parts by mass of calcium chloride, 12 parts by mass of ash calcium and 10 parts by mass of nano activated carbon powder into stirring equipment, and uniformly mixing and stirring;
2. 2 parts of plasticizer, 2 parts of polyethylene wax emulsion, 2 parts of water-soluble silicone oil, 18 parts of dichlorooctyl isothiazolinone and 2 parts of dispersant by mass are put into a high-speed dispersion machine and stirred and dispersed uniformly, the mixed powder obtained in the step 1 is added into the uniformly dispersed liquid mixture, the mixture is stirred and dispersed continuously, and finally 22 parts of deionized water by weight are put into the high-speed dispersion machine and dispersed at high speed for 20 minutes and then dispersed at low speed for 1 hour;
3. 2 parts of defoaming agent is added into the mixed solution after low-speed dispersion in the step 2, and the mixture is slowly mixed, stirred and defoamed;
4. and (3) feeding the defoamed mixed solution into a distillation concentration device for distillation concentration to obtain a paste, detecting the quality, and finally cutting and packaging according to the net content of 25 kg/block.
